Key Components and Features:

Sensor Array:

        Air quality monitoring devices utilize a range of sensors for different pollutants, ensuring comprehensive and accurate data collection.

Data Analytics:

        Advanced data analytics processes the collected information, providing real-time insights into air quality trends, pollution sources, and potential health risks.

Wireless Connectivity:

        Many devices feature wireless connectivity, enabling remote data transmission and real-time monitoring through online platforms or mobile applications.

Integration with IoT:

        Integration with the Internet of Things (IoT) allows seamless communication between devices, supporting a networked approach for comprehensive air quality management.

Geospatial Mapping:

        Some devices offer geospatial mapping capabilities, allowing users to visualize air quality variations across different locations.

Alert Systems:

        Air quality monitoring devices often include alert systems that notify authorities and the public when pollutant levels exceed predefined thresholds, facilitating timely interventions.

Weather Integration:

        Integration with weather data enhances the understanding of how meteorological conditions influence air quality, providing a more holistic assessment.

Long-Term Trend Analysis:

        These devices facilitate long-term trend analysis, helping authorities formulate effective policies and regulations to improve air quality.

Case Examples:

  • Urban Air Quality Management: Deployed in cities to monitor pollutants, such as particulate matter (PM), nitrogen dioxide (NO2), and ozone (O3), for regulatory compliance and public health.
  • Industrial Emissions Monitoring: Used in industrial facilities to track and control emissions, ensuring compliance with environmental regulations and minimizing the impact on air quality.
  • Wildfire Smoke Monitoring: Employed in areas prone to wildfires to assess and alert communities about the presence of harmful air pollutants from smoke, aiding public safety measures.
  • Transportation Air Pollution Monitoring: Installed near highways and transportation hubs to measure pollutants emitted by vehicles, contributing to efforts to reduce traffic-related air pollution and improve overall air quality.
  • Urban Air Quality Assessment: Deployed in urban areas to monitor and analyze air pollutants, such as particulate matter (PM), carbon monoxide (CO), and sulfur dioxide (SO2), to assess overall air quality and support environmental management initiatives

U.S. Regulations that Enviro Smart Rentals’ Products Related to Air Quality Monitoring for Environmental Measurement Technologies for Real Estate and Rental and Leasing Comply with:

  • Environmental Protection Agency (EPA): The EPA sets standards and regulations related to air quality monitoring to ensure adherence to environmental guidelines.
  • Occupational Safety and Health Administration (OSHA): OSHA regulations may apply if the technology is used in occupational settings to monitor air quality and ensure workplace safety.
  • National Ambient Air Quality Standards (NAAQS): NAAQS established by the EPA define acceptable levels of air pollutants to protect public health and the environment.
  • Clean Air Act (CAA): The CAA outlines regulations aimed at improving and maintaining air quality, addressing issues such as emissions and pollution control.
  • Federal Communications Commission (FCC): If the air quality monitoring devices involve wireless communication, compliance with FCC regulations on radio frequency (RF) devices may be necessary.
